Florida RB Lamical Perine









I brought him up in the Etiene thread when nobody else had mentioned him. That surprised me because the kid has it all ...vision, speed to take it the distance, contact balance, receiving skills (Gators lined him up everywhere), etc. Zero career fumbles.

He was voted Senior Bowl practice player of the week and had a nice one-hand snag on a screen for a TD in the game.

Im fully aware of the other backs in this class and what they bring to the table but Perine absolutely wreaks of a Brett Veach steal.

The similarities are startling...

Toledo RB Kareem Hunt (2017 Combine) -- Age 21.6 years, 5'11" 216 lbs, 9.63 inch hands, 31.38 inch arms, 4.62 40 yd dash, 36.5 inch vert, 18 Bench Press Reps, 119.0 inch broad jump, 4.51 short shuttle(pro day)

Florida RB La'Mical Perine (2020 Combine) -- Age 22.1 years, 5'11" 216 lbs, 10.25 inch hands, 31.63 inch arms, 4.62 40 yd dash, 35 inch vert, 22 Bench Press Reps, 118.0 inch broad jump, 4.31 short shuttle
